Write True/False for the following:

  1. Natural magnets are permanent magnets.
  2. All current-carrying conductors may not produce the magnetic effect.
  3. All electromagnets are solenoids.
  4. Electromagnetism is responsible for working with speakers.
  5. A solenoid creates the uniform magnetic field.
  6. Magnetic strength decreases with increase in current.
  7. Magnetic strength increases with increase in a number of turns in the coil in the solenoid.

Answer: 1 → T, 2→ F, 3 → F, 4 → T, 5 → T, 6 → F, 7 → T
